Auto Stringing in Solargraf

Published on 10 Jul 2026

Solargraf's new "Auto Stringing" feature streamlines the process of automatically connecting individual solar panels into strings, a critical step in solar array design that directly affects system performance.

This feature is primarily designed for systems using string inverters, which require panels to be connected in series to form strings. Because microinverter systems assign an individual inverter to each panel, eliminating the need for complex stringing calculations, the direct impact of auto-stringing is less pronounced.


Using Auto-stringing: A step by step guide

String inverter

Within Solar design tab, after panel placement,

  • Click on Add inverter button.

  • Select the string inverter and (optionally) optimizer or rapid shutdown/MCI you want to use.

  • Once you've made your selections, click "Complete stringing” button.

  • Solargraf automatically creates optimal strings within seconds, maximizing energy output and minimizing project costs by optimizing string number and length within structural and electrical limits. It also determines the number and placement of inverters.

  • You can manually adjust the generated strings or inverter positions if needed.

  • Solargraf will immediately notify you of any stringing validation issues, allowing you to correct them and rerun the auto-stringing tool.

Microinverter

Within Solar design tab or electrical design tab, after panels and microinverters placement,

  • Click the stringing icon (or use the shortcut "B").

  • Click String for me button.

  • Solargraf automatically connects microinverters into optimal parallel branches within seconds, optimizing the number and length of branches within structural and electrical limits.

  • You can manually adjust the generated branches or microinverter placement if needed. This branching is the first step in generating Single Line Diagrams (SLDs).

While auto-stringing's primary benefit is streamlining series connections for string inverters, it also simplifies parallel connections in microinverter systems, essential for SLD generation within Solargraf's Electrical Design tab.
